Can't Not Tour

The Can't Not Tour (also known as Jagged Little Tour or Intellectual Intercourse Tour) is the debut concert tour by Canadian singer-songwriter Alanis Morissette. The tour supported her third studio album, Jagged Little Pill (1995).

Several songs that were written on the road alternated through several positions on the set list. Other songs included "I Don't Know (The Weekend Song)", "I Don't Know (A Year Like This One)", and "Death Of Cinderella". Occasionally, covers of other bands would surface including Radiohead's "Fake Plastic Trees", The Beatles' "Happiness Is A Warm Gun", "There Are Worse Things I Could Do" from the Grease soundtrack.
